Welcome to a new topic and our topic today is about the death of the sun.



According to the research and theories of scientists, it is possible that the sun will die after about 4,5,000,000 years, in a study published in the (Space) magazine concerned with talking about space sciences.


And some scientists added that the problem will start before the death of the sun, as at that time the problem begins with dealing with the old sun, and that this death is caused by the continuity of hydrogen fusion inside the sun, accumulating as a result of these interactions in the nucleus of the element helium.


With all the waste scattered around the sun, it is difficult for the sun to carry out the process of fusion, but the internal weight of the sun’s atmosphere does not change, so to maintain its balance, it must increase the temperature of the reactions that take place inside it, which leads to a hotter core.


As the sun ages, the earth will become uncontrollably hotter, the earth's atmosphere will vanish and the oceans, seas, rivers, and lakes will evaporate, and for a while the earth will look like a flower and lock its inhabitants in a stifling atmosphere full of carbon dioxide CO2. .


And in the last stages, the sun turns into a huge and giant structure of red color called (the red giant) and drains Mercury and Venus, and if the atmosphere of the sun reaches the Earth, it will melt it in less than a day.



And if the expansion of the sun stops for a short period of time, this will not be good for the Earth, as the energy emitted from the sun will be so intense that the rocks evaporate and leave only the dense iron core from the planet.


The increased radiation will lead to the destruction of the outer planets and in the final stages of death The sun repeatedly bulges and deflates and pulses for millions of years and the chaotic sun will push out the outer planets, And it will pull them in strange directions, which may attract them to their deadly rapture, or completely expel them from the solar system. With a lot of heat and radiation flowing, the habitable zone, the area around the star where the temperatures are suitable for the presence of liquid water, and eventually the sun gives up the struggle. Ignoring its outer shell in a series of explosions, leaving the star's core a hot white mass of carbon and oxygen, which is what is known as the white dwarf. Within about a billion years, the white dwarf will stabilize and simply stop after trillions of years.


This faint dwarf will host a new habitable region, but because this star is so cold, that region will be incredibly close, much closer to the sun than Mercury.
